The relationship between micronutrient status and sleep patterns: a systematic review.
Xiaopeng Ji1, Michael A Grandner2, Jianghong Liu1
11School of Nursing, University of Pennsylvania,418 Curie Blvd,Philadelphia,PA 19104,USA.
Public Health Nutrition
|October 6, 2016
Summary
Micronutrients like iron and magnesium may influence sleep stages and duration. Further research is needed to understand the complex relationship between micronutrient status and sleep health across all ages.

Background:
- Sleep patterns are crucial for overall health and well-being.
- Micronutrients play vital roles in various physiological processes, potentially including sleep regulation.
- Existing research suggests a possible link between nutrient status and sleep quality.
Purpose of the Study:
- To systematically review existing literature on the association between dietary and circulating micronutrients and sleep patterns.
- To identify gaps and implications for future research and public health practices concerning micronutrients and sleep.
Main Methods:
- A systematic review of studies was conducted.
- Searches were performed in PubMed, Embase, and Scopus databases up to January 2016.
- Included both experimental and observational studies, excluding those focused on sleep impairment due to comorbidities.
Main Results:
- Twenty-six articles were selected for review.
- Micronutrients, particularly iron (Fe) and magnesium (Mg), show potential roles in infant sleep stage development and age-related sleep architecture.
- Sleep duration is positively associated with Fe, zinc (Zn), and Mg, and negatively with copper (Cu), potassium (K), and vitamin B12.
Conclusions:
- Emerging evidence suggests a link between micronutrient status and sleep, despite a low number of studies.
- Further research is required to explore dose-dependent and longitudinal relationships, nutrient interactions, and clinical relevance for sleep health.

Insufficient Sleep and Sleep Deprivation
1.2K
Insufficient sleep refers to not getting the recommended amount of sleep for optimal functioning, even if it's just slightly less than needed. Sleep insufficiency may occur due to lifestyle choices, such as staying up late for social events or work, resulting in routinely getting less sleep than required. For example, consistently sleeping 6 hours when the body needs 7-9 hours can lead to cumulative effects on health and well-being.

Understanding Sleep
1.8K
Sleep, an essential biological state, involves significant reductions in physical activity, sensory awareness, and interaction with the environment. This complex physiological process is primarily regulated by specific brain regions, notably the hypothalamus and pons, which govern the sleep-wake cycle or circadian rhythm.

Insomnia is a prevalent sleep disorder characterized by difficulty falling asleep, frequent awakenings during the night, and waking up too early without being able to return to sleep. People with insomnia often experience these disruptions at least three nights a week for at least one month. Chronic insomnia, which lasts for at least three months, can lead to increased anxiety, which in turn can worsen sleep difficulties, creating a cycle of sleeplessness and stress.

Correlation means that there is a relationship between two or more variables (such as ice cream consumption and crime), but this relationship does not necessarily imply cause and effect. When two variables are correlated, it simply means that as one variable changes, so does the other. We can measure correlation by calculating a statistic known as a correlation coefficient.
